Std Test Clinics In Bangkok Or Chiang Mai

Featured Replies

Hi, does anyone know the cost to get tested for STDs in either Bangkok or Chiang Mai and does anyone know the time it takes to recieve results? Is one quicker/cheaper than the other?

Can anyone reccomend a clinic and tell me where abouts it is?

Thanks a lot

Tested for what specifically?

I got HIV results in 1 hour

My Hep A/B/C in 4 hours

I know the chalamydia used to take 2 days but have heard there is a new test.

Syph and Ghon + some others I do not know as the results came back with my yearly health screening a week later.

I got my first HIv + Hep at Bumrungrad in Bangkok - cost 2200THB

The second whole batch i do not know as at Raffles Hopital in singapore as part of a full package.

Hi I have tested myself in some of the small clinics you can find throughout BKK.

Cost about 800 Bath for HIV and some other things (I dunno what I just asked STD and HIV test)

Result in less then one hour.

As the posters above have said, the time depends on the type of test.

HIV is quick. Syphilis can be same day. Gonorrhea and chlamydia might take a few days.

As to where -- any hospital can do these. A number of people have also recommended the Red Cross clinic in BKK, do a search of this thread and you should find the location details.

There are a lot of small clinics advertising STD testing in Bkk but I'd be a bit wary of them, quality of testing is unknown.
